Controlling the Colors You See
You want your photos to look as good as possible and to have beautiful, breathtaking color.
Heck, that's probably why you bought Elements. But now that you've got the program,
you're likely having a little trouble getting things to look the way you want. Does the follow-
ing situation sound familiar?
▪ Your photos look great onscreen, but your prints are washed out, too dark, or the colors
are all a little wrong.
▪ Your photos look fine in programs like Word or Windows Explorer, but they look awful
in Elements.
